Inertia terms for all Mach number Godunov-type schemes: behavior of unsteady solutions at low Mach number

open access: yes, 2014
Inertia terms are introduced in a Godunoy-type scheme. The resulting scheme, called AUSM-IT, is designed as an extension of the AUSM+-up scheme, in order to allow full Mach number range calculations of unsteady flows. Transonic flutter study of a 50.5 deg cropped-delta wing with two rearward-mounted nacelles [PDF]

open access: yes
Transonic flutter characteristics of three geometrically similar delta-wing models were experimentally determined in the Langley transonic dynamics tunnel at Mach numbers from about 0.6 to 1.2.
